The Tijjaniyya sect has announced its annual Maulud of Sheikh Ibrahim Nyass is postponed indefinitely, citing the outbreak of Covid-19 in the country—the same day the country confirmed a third person was infected with coronavirus

Leader of the sect Dahiru Usman Bauchi said the event was suspended following advice from medical and public health officials to avoid the spread of coronavirus.
